FileOperationsExtensions.ListFromTaskAsync Method

Definition

Lists the files in a Task's directory on its Compute Node.

public static System.Threading.Tasks.Task<Microsoft.Rest.Azure.IPage<Microsoft.Azure.Batch.Protocol.Models.NodeFile>> ListFromTaskAsync (this Microsoft.Azure.Batch.Protocol.IFileOperations operations, string jobId, string taskId, bool? recursive = default, Microsoft.Azure.Batch.Protocol.Models.FileListFromTaskOptions fileListFromTaskOptions = default, System.Threading.CancellationToken cancellationToken = default);
static member ListFromTaskAsync : Microsoft.Azure.Batch.Protocol.IFileOperations * string * string * Nullable<bool> * Microsoft.Azure.Batch.Protocol.Models.FileListFromTaskOptions *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Rest.Azure.IPage<Microsoft.Azure.Batch.Protocol.Models.NodeFile>>
<Extension()>
Public Function ListFromTaskAsync (operations As IFileOperations, jobId As String, taskId As String, Optional recursive As Nullable(Of Boolean) = Nothing, Optional fileListFromTaskOptions As FileListFromTaskOptions = Nothing, Optional cancellationToken As CancellationToken = Nothing) As Task(Of IPage(Of NodeFile))

Parameters

operations
IFileOperations

The operations group for this extension method.

jobId
String

The ID of the Job that contains the Task.

taskId
String

The ID of the Task whose files you want to list.

recursive
Nullable<Boolean>

Whether to list children of the Task directory. This parameter can be used in combination with the filter parameter to list specific type of files.

fileListFromTaskOptions
FileListFromTaskOptions

Additional parameters for the operation

cancellationToken
CancellationToken

The cancellation token.

Returns

Applies to